Headquartered in beautiful Boulder, Colorado,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's (NOAA), Space Weather Prediction Center (SWPC) provides the Nation's official Space Weather Services to meet growing user demands for space weather information. The Center is one of the nine National Centers for Environmental Prediction (NCEP) within the National Weather Service (NWS). SWPC continually monitors and forecasts space weather; provides accurate, reliable, and useful solar-terrestrial information; conducts and leads research and development programs; and, transitions promising models and techniques into operational products to improve space weather services.
